Cost of living in Timisoara, Romania compared to Adana, Turkey
Currency:
Food | + 25% | |||

Food in Timisoara (Romania) is 25% more expensive than in Adana (Turkey) | ||||
Basic lunchtime menu (including a drink) in the business district | 17 lei (18TL) | 18TL | + 3% | |
Combo meal in fast food restaurant (Big Mac Meal or similar) | 16 lei (17TL) | 14TL | + 21% | |
500 gr (1 lb.) of boneless chicken breast | 12 lei (12TL) | 8TL | + 64% | |
1 liter (1 qt.) of whole fat milk | 4.11 lei (4.38TL) | 2.57TL | + 70% | |
12 eggs, large | 6 lei (7TL) | 6TL | + 4% | |
1 kg (2 lb.) of tomatoes | 5.11 lei (5.45TL) | 2.56TL | + 113% | |
500 gr (16 oz.) of local cheese | 15 lei (16TL) | 8TL | + 97% | |
1 kg (2 lb.) of apples | 3.61 lei (3.86TL) | 3.41TL | + 13% | |
1 kg (2 lb.) of potatoes | 2.17 lei (2.31TL) | 1.56TL | + 48% | |
0.5 l (16 oz) domestic beer in the supermarket | 3.08 lei (3.29TL) | 6TL | - 49% | |
1 bottle of red table wine, good quality | 16 lei (17TL) | 36TL | - 54% | |
2 liters of Coca-Cola | 5.79 lei (6TL) | 2.92TL | + 112% | |
Bread for 2 people for 1 day | 2.72 lei (2.91TL) | 1.07TL | + 171% | |
Housing | + 41% | |||
Housing in Timisoara (Romania) is 41% more expensive than in Adana (Turkey) | ||||
Monthly rent for 85 m2 (900 Sqft) furnished accommodation in EXPENSIVE area | 1,851 lei (1,976TL) | 831TL | + 138% | |
Monthly rent for 85 m2 (900 Sqft) furnished accommodation in NORMAL area | 1,263 lei (1,348TL) | 687TL | + 96% | |
Utilities 1 month (heating, electricity, gas ...) for 2 people in 85m2 flat | 376 lei (401TL) | 230TL | + 74% | |
Monthly rent for a 45 m2 (480 Sqft) furnished studio in EXPENSIVE area | 960 lei (1,025TL) | 747TL | + 37% | |
Monthly rent for a 45 m2 (480 Sqft) furnished studio in NORMAL area | 730 lei (779TL) | 667TL | + 17% | |
Utilities 1 month (heating, electricity, gas ...) for 1 person in 45 m2 (480 Sqft) studio | 295 lei (315TL) | 338TL | - 7% | |
Internet 8 Mbps (1 month) | 34 lei (36TL) | 62TL | - 41% | |
40” flat screen TV | 1,502 lei (1,603TL) | 1,590TL | + 1% | |
Microwave 800/900 Watt (Bosch, Panasonic, LG, Sharp, or equivalent brands) | 331 lei (354TL) | 300TL | + 18% | |
Laundry detergent (3 l. ~ 100 oz.) | 34 lei (37TL) | 12TL | + 197% | |
Hourly rate for cleaning help | 19 lei (20TL) | 12TL | + 65% | |
Clothes | + 86% | |||
Clothes in Timisoara (Romania) is 86% more expensive than in Adana (Turkey) | ||||
1 pair of jeans (Levis 501 or similar) | 190 lei (203TL) | 121TL | + 68% | |
1 summer dress in a High Street Store (Zara, H&M or similar retailers) | 130 lei (139TL) | 72TL | + 93% | |
1 pair of sport shoes (Nike, Adidas, or equivalent brands) | 262 lei (279TL) | 157TL | + 78% | |
1 pair of men’s leather business shoes | 287 lei (307TL) | 154TL | + 99% | |
Transportation | + 5% | |||
Transportation in Timisoara (Romania) is 5% more expensive than in Adana (Turkey) | ||||
Volkswagen Golf 1.4 TSI 150 CV (or equivalent), with no extras, new | 79,600 lei (84,958TL) | 79,014TL | + 8% | |
1 liter (1/4 gallon) of gas | 5.34 lei (5.70TL) | 4.69TL | + 22% | |
Monthly ticket public transport | 60 lei (64TL) | 71TL | - 9% | |
Taxi trip on a business day, basic tariff, 8 km. (5 miles) | 22 lei (23TL) | - | - | |
Personal Care | + 41% | |||
Personal Care in Timisoara (Romania) is 41% more expensive than in Adana (Turkey) | ||||
Cold medicine for 6 days (Tylenol, Frenadol, Coldrex, or equivalent brands) | 28 lei (30TL) | 11TL | + 178% | |
1 box of antibiotics (12 doses) | 26 lei (28TL) | 10TL | + 171% | |
Short visit to private Doctor (15 minutes) | 96 lei (102TL) | 105TL | - 3% | |
1 box of 32 tampons (Tampax, OB, ...) | 17 lei (18TL) | 9TL | + 100% | |
Deodorant, roll-on (50ml ~ 1.5 oz.) | 14 lei (15TL) | 12TL | + 23% | |
Hair shampoo 2-in-1 (400 ml ~ 12 oz.) | 14 lei (15TL) | 10TL | + 45% | |
4 rolls of toilet paper | 4.80 lei (5.12TL) | 3.70TL | + 38% | |
Tube of toothpaste | 10 lei (11TL) | 5.70TL | + 91% | |
Standard men's haircut in expat area of the city | 21 lei (22TL) | 16TL | + 37% | |
Entertainment | + 17% | |||
Entertainment in Timisoara (Romania) is 17% more expensive than in Adana (Turkey) | ||||
Basic dinner out for two in neighborhood pub | 60 lei (64TL) | 37TL | + 74% | |
2 tickets to the movies | 40 lei (43TL) | 29TL | + 49% | |
2 tickets to the theater (best available seats) | 108 lei (115TL) | 37TL | + 213% | |
Dinner for two at an Italian restaurant in the expat area including appetisers, main course, wine and dessert | 85 lei (91TL) | 69TL | + 31% | |
1 cocktail drink in downtown club | 18 lei (19TL) | 22TL | - 15% | |
Cappuccino in expat area of the city | 5.11 lei (5.45TL) | 9TL | - 37% | |
1 beer in neighbourhood pub (500ml or 1pt.) | 5.00 lei (5.34TL) | 9TL | - 42% | |
iPad Wi-Fi 128GB | 2,509 lei (2,678TL) | - | - | |
1 min. of prepaid mobile tariff (no discounts or plans) | 0.56 lei (0.60TL) | 0.38TL | + 59% | |
1 month of gym membership in business district | 106 lei (113TL) | 117TL | - 3% | |
1 package of Marlboro cigarettes | 15 lei (16TL) | 10TL | + 59% | |
TOTAL | + 24% |

These prices were last updated on April 26, 2018.

Cost of living in Timisoara (Romania) is 24% more expensive than in Adana (Turkey)
For example, you would need at least 2,973TL
(2,785 lei)
in Timisoara
to maintain the same standard of living that you can have with
2,400TL
in Adana.
